The problem

Space is powerful. Access to it is still bespoke.

Using space capability today means coordinating separate operators, spacecraft, ground networks, compute environments, APIs, and constraints by hand. Every team rebuilds the same integration work. Nomos is building the abstraction above it.

The network

Different infrastructure. One interface.

Nomos does not replace satellites, ground stations, or clouds. It sits above them: an intelligence layer that reasons across orbital, ground, and cloud resources and determines which of them should take part in fulfilling each request.

How it works

The intelligence loop

01

Express the outcome

Describe what you need: objective, area, timing, constraints. Not which satellite, which antenna, which cluster.

02

Understand the environment

Nomos evaluates orbital geometry, public catalogs, contact opportunities, and the infrastructure represented in the system.

03

Determine the path

Nomos compares feasible ways to fulfill the request and explains why a path was selected, with sources and assumptions attached.

04

Planned · requires integrations

Execute across the network

As providers integrate, recommendations become execution: tasking, downlink, and compute coordinated through one interface.

Product maturity

What exists today

The intelligence layer ships first. Execution arrives with integrations. The distinction is labeled everywhere it matters.

Available now

  • Intelligence

    Search and reason over real public datasets and infrastructure references.

  • Orbital geometry

    Contact opportunities calculated from real orbital data.

  • Routing

    Feasible satellite, ground, and cloud processing paths compared and ranked.

  • Provenance

    Sources, assumptions, constraints, and reasoning exposed on every result.

  • Simulation

    Execution behavior explored with clearly labeled simulated candidates where live integrations do not exist yet.

Coming with network integrations

These require live provider connections. Nomos labels them on every result instead of inventing them.

  • Satellite tasking
  • Ground-station reservation
  • Onboard workload execution
  • Private telemetry
  • Live commercial availability and pricing
  • Automated multi-provider execution
